
The Marquette Golden Eagles are favored to beat U-W-Green Bay tonight (Tuesday) by more than 20 points.
If the upset win over the Wisconsin Badgers is going to be the start of an excellent season for coach Steve Wojciechowski’s team, a statement win over the Phoenix would be a good way to maintain the momentum.
Green Bay has a chance to be decent this season, but it’s winless so far.
Marquette is tasked with proving the two-point win over the Badgers wasn’t a fluke.
Even more important – giving a good showing Friday on the West Coast against the U-C-L-A Bruins.
That could make the meeting with the Phoenix a “trap game.”
